INSPECT CHARCOAL CANISTER ASSEMBLY
Check the appearance.
Visually check the charcoal canister assembly for cracks or damage.
If necessary, replace the charcoal canister assembly.
Check the charcoal canister filter.

Detach the 2 claws and remove the charcoal canister filter.
| *1 | Charcoal Canister Filter |
Visually check that the charcoal canister filter is not excessively damaged or dirty.
If necessary, replace the charcoal canister assembly.
Check the charcoal canister operation.

Blow air (4.7 kPa (0.05 kgf/cm2, 0.7 psi)) into port A, then check that the air flows from ports B and C.
If the ventilation is not as specified, replace the charcoal canister assembly.
Clean the filter in canister.

Clean the filter by blowing (19.6 kpa (0.2 kgf/cm2, 2.8 psi)) compressed air into port B while holding port A closed.
Note
Do not attempt to wash the charcoal canister assembly.
No activated carbon should come out.
Install the charcoal canister filter.
